THURSDAY APRIL 21, 1898
YOUNG LIFE ENDED
Mrs. Carl Chase Died at Her Home Yesterday.
Mrs. Madie Chase, the young wife of Carl Chase, a Memphis fireman, died yesterday morning at her home 114 South Little street, of a complication of diseases.
Mrs. Chase was former Miss Harris, and was married only last November. She was 21 years of age and had lived in this city for several years. Her amiable disposition and cheerful manner gained for her many friends who are deeply grieved by her death.
The funeral will occur from her home at 3 o'clock this afternoon. Rev. Lovett of the Baptist church, will conduct the services.
